Pros
  • Official, well-tested abstractions
  • Same primitives as Claude Code
  • Strong tool-use ergonomics
  • TypeScript + Python SDKs
  • 1M-token context window via novel MSA sparse attention
  • Aggressive token pricing vs Claude/GPT for high-volume workloads
  • One account covers text, code, video, speech, and music models
  • Has its own IDE-like coding workspace and agent runtime
Cons
  • Claude-only
  • Newer than LangGraph/CrewAI
  • China-headquartered provider raises data-residency and procurement friction
  • English docs and ecosystem trail OpenAI/Anthropic maturity
  • Model quality on hard reasoning still below frontier US labs in independent evals
